web-dev-qa-db-ja.com

./zshrcが破損しています。 WSL bashを開くとクラッシュする

私はWSLにいます。私はbashからzshに行き、これに基づいて アドバイス nvm、node、npmコマンドを使用できるようにするためにsource ~/.bashrcファイルの先頭に~/.zshrcを追加しましたzshで。しかし、WSL bashを開くと、次のような無限のエラーが表示されます...

enter image description here

ctrl+cexitを試してみましたが、何もしません...他のアイデアを試すには〜/ .zshrcに戻る必要があります。

1
kyw

特定のコマンドでubuntu.exeを実行して、ログインシェルをバイパスします。これらのコマンドのいずれかのようなもの:

ubuntu.exe run bash
ubuntu.exe -c bash
ubuntu.exe -c vim .zshrc

次に、bashまたはVimを使用してzshrcを修正します。

.bash_profileからの.bashrcまたは.zshrcの調達は、terribleアドバイスです。 nodejs設定を.bashrcから.zshrcにコピーするか、.bashrcおよび.zshrcからの別のファイルとソースに配置する方が良いでしょう。

3
muru